Costain are recruiting for a **Digital Delivery Lead** to join our team delivering the Southern Water CMDP framework.
**About The Project**
CMDP is a joint venture between Costain and MWHT and delivers a range of schemes to maintain and improve Southern Water's water supply and wastewater treatment works in the eastern half of its region (Kent & Sussex)
This new position will be based across our Chatham (Kent) and Falmer (Brighton) offices with regional travel to projects
**About the role**
CMDP seek a digitally passionate individual with a creative mindset to drive the digital delivery agenda. With an appreciation of 4D modelling, digital rehearsal facilitation and strong interpersonal skills, this role is about bridging the gap between engineering and delivery functions through collaborative practices. There will be support from both Central and Regional Digital Leads and opportunities to train and develop across the broad spectrum of digital delivery tools.
**Key Responsibilities**
Work in parallel with the Digital Engineering and Delivery Manager to energise the adoption of the digital delivery agenda within the CMDP framework
Manage the digital delivery toolbox maturity matrix to ensure we are meeting our commitments and work closely with Regional Leads to identify key resources to build a strategic, in region, team
Work with regional Digital Delivery Leads to develop regional strategies covering the tools, techniques, and training necessary for integration as business as usual into the regional delivery processes
Work closely with the Regional Leads identifying resources, both facilitators and technicians, to prepare, deliver and run rehearsals for their programmes of work
Develop 4D models utilising Synchro for Digital Rehearsals, linking the model and programme, to provide visualisations
Facilitate rehearsals on specific projects until resources are identified, competent and capable
Develop, implement, and execute the strategy to fully adopt the use BIM 360 Field across the region, embedding the platform as business as usual for project delivery
Continuously look for synergies in regional processes and system functionality
**About You**
4D Synchro software experience (preferred but not essential)
Appreciation on real critical path management and control and background in scheduling
Good communication skills, presentation skills and computer skills
